Let's Talk About Attitude, Dude

Attitude 


We don't always have control over what's happening around us, but we do always have control over our attitude.


Your attitude is an active choice.


Throughout the day you may choose to respond to something – or simply carry yourself – with a negative attitude.


Or, you may choose to respond and carry yourself with a positive attitude.


Negative attitudes bring down everyone around you. Choosing to mope around with a negative attitude also decreases your chances of accomplishing your goals. 


A positive attitude builds up everyone around you. It's contagious. It can turn multiple people's bad days into good days. 


It's amazing how melancholy and negative people choose to carry themselves, knowing that it negatively affects them and everyone around them.


We can't control everything in our lives, which is why we should focus on managing, worrying, and acting on what we can control.


Attitude is something we always have complete control over.


Choose to have a positive attitude.


Your life will improve and you'll positively impact everyone – even strangers – around you.


No one benefits from a sourpuss.
